BITZER Kühlmaschinenbau GmbH Sustainability Profile

Company website

BITZER Kühlmaschinenbau GmbH, headquartered in Germany, is a leading manufacturer in the refrigeration and air conditioning industry. Founded in 1934, the company has established a strong presence in Europe and beyond, specialising in high-quality compressors, condensing units, and pressure vessels. With a commitment to innovation, BITZER is renowned for its energy-efficient solutions that cater to various applications, including commercial refrigeration and industrial cooling. The company’s unique offerings, such as its advanced semi-hermetic and scroll compressors, set it apart in a competitive market. BITZER Kühlmaschinenbau GmbH's reported carbon emissions

Inherited from Bitzer SE

BITZER Kühlmaschinenbau GmbH, headquartered in Germany, currently does not report specific carbon emissions data, as indicated by the absence of emissions figures. The company is a current subsidiary of Bitzer SE, which may influence its climate commitments and performance metrics. While BITZER Kühlmaschinenbau GmbH has not outlined specific reduction targets or initiatives, it is important to note that the parent company, Bitzer SE, may have established climate strategies that could impact its subsidiaries. However, no specific details regarding these initiatives or targets have been provided.
